Man Robbed In Tigard Shopping Center Parking Lot
A 22-year-old Tualatin man called 9-1-1 and reported he was robbed by gunpoint. The victim told police the incident occurred just after he exited his parked vehicle. The robbery reportedly happened in the parking lot of a Tigard shopping center located at 13500 SW Pacific Highway just after 8:00 pm on Sunday evening, March 27th. Once notified, Tigard Police Officers checked the location for witnesses and evidence.
According to the victim, two suspects approached him from behind as he headed away from his car. The first suspect, described as white or Hispanic, demanded the victim's wallet. The suspect was further described as having a light complexion and wearing a black hooded sweatshirt at the time. His age is unknown. The victim recalled seeing a colored heart tattoo with an arrow on the suspect's right forearm. During the ordeal the second suspect, described as an adult white male, heavy set and approximately 5'9" tall, struck the victim on the head with the handgun he was carrying. The victim did not require medical treatment for any injuries.
Police reports indicate the suspects emptied the victim's wallet of its contents and threw it to the ground as the pair ran to a nearby vehicle. The suspect vehicle is described as a green, mid-90s Honda Civic. The suspect vehicle was being driven by a third suspect. The victim was not able to obtain the license plate.
